How to add a menu in Teststand

Teststand provide a way to allow user to add menu item in process model, for example, I can add an "example" item under "configure" menu. However, is there any way to allow user to add menus?.

You add Configure Menu Items by adding 'Configuration Entry Point' sequences to your Process Model.  There are three default 'Configuration Entry Point' sequences in the Sequential Process Model (they are the lighter purple colour)  Configure Report, Database and Model Options.  These will be displayed in the confiure menu when a Sequence file that uses the Sequential Process Model is selected.
 
You could just copy one of these sequences, in the process model, and modify it for your requirements.

You cannot add a new menu.

You can only add items to the Configure menu and to the Tools menu.
